After five years of faithful service, this Uncrate editor's Bose remote finally died this past week, so we began a frantic search for a universal remote that could handle our myriad home theater devices. The Logitech Harmony 890 Pro Remote ($400) seems like the right fit for our needs. It features easy setup via USB, a macro-driven color menu system, a fully-backlit control pad, and, unlike the Harmony 880 which uses IR signals, the 890 works via RF so we can still change tracks on the Bose from the other room.
